php怎么读取指定文件内容
-
要读取指定文件的内容,可以使用PHP中的`file_get_contents()`函数。
`file_get_contents()`函数用于将整个文件读入一个字符串中。它的参数是要读取的文件的路径,返回值是文件的内容。
下面是一个示例代码:
“`php
// 指定要读取的文件路径
$filePath = ‘path/to/file.txt’;// 使用file_get_contents()函数读取文件内容
$fileContent = file_get_contents($filePath);// 输出文件内容
echo $fileContent;
“`在示例代码中,你需要将`$filePath`变量替换为你要读取的文件的实际路径。
注意,在使用`file_get_contents()`函数读取文件内容时,需要确保PHP脚本对要读取的文件有足够的权限。如果文件不存在或没有读取权限,函数将返回`false`。
另外,如果要读取的文件比较大或者需要逐行读取文件内容,可以使用`fopen()`和`fgets()`函数进行文件读取操作。
希望以上内容能帮助到你!
2年前 -
PHP可以使用file_get_contents()函数来读取指定文件的内容。这个函数的语法是:file_get_contents(文件路径)。下面是具体的步骤:
1. 确定要读取的文件路径。可以是相对路径或绝对路径。如果文件在项目根目录下,可以直接使用文件名。如果文件在子目录下,需要加上相应的目录路径。
2. 使用file_get_contents()函数读取文件内容。将要读取的文件路径作为该函数的参数。函数会返回文件的内容,可以保存在一个变量中。
3. 处理文件内容。可以对文件内容进行处理和操作,例如提取特定信息、转换格式等。
4. 关闭文件。虽然file_get_contents()函数不需要打开文件,但是在处理完文件内容后,建议使用fclose()函数来关闭文件。
5. 输出文件内容。可以将文件内容输出到浏览器或保存到其他文件中,具体取决于需求。
下面是一个示例代码:
“`
$filePath = ‘path/to/file.txt’; // 读取文件的路径$fileContent = file_get_contents($filePath); // 读取文件内容
// 在这里可以对文件内容进行处理
$outputFile = ‘path/to/output.txt’; // 输出文件的路径
file_put_contents($outputFile, $fileContent); // 将文件内容保存到输出文件中
“`上述代码会将指定文件的内容读取出来,并保存到另一个文件中。根据具体需求和处理逻辑,可以对文件内容进行其他操作和处理。注意,读取文件时需要确保文件有足够的权限。
2年前 -
在PHP中,读取指定文件的内容可以通过以下方法和操作流程来实现。
操作流程:
1. 打开文件:使用PHP的文件打开函数fopen()来打开指定的文件,需要提供文件路径和打开模式。
2. 读取文件内容:使用PHP的文件读取函数fread()或者file_get_contents()来读取文件的内容,需要提供文件句柄或者文件路径作为参数。
3. 关闭文件:使用PHP的文件关闭函数fclose()来关闭文件句柄,以释放资源。下面是具体的操作步骤:
1. 使用fopen()函数打开文件:
“`php
$file = fopen(‘path/to/file.txt’, ‘r’);
“`
这里的第一个参数是文件的路径,可以是相对路径或者绝对路径。第二个参数是打开文件的模式,’r’表示只读方式打开文件。2. 使用fread()函数读取文件内容:
“`php
$content = fread($file, filesize(‘path/to/file.txt’));
“`
这里的第一个参数是文件句柄,即fopen()函数返回的值。第二个参数是要读取的文件大小,可以使用filesize()函数获取文件的大小。3. 关闭文件:
“`php
fclose($file);
“`
使用fclose()函数关闭文件句柄,以释放资源。另外,也可以使用file_get_contents()函数一次性读取整个文件的内容:
“`php
$content = file_get_contents(‘path/to/file.txt’);
“`
这个函数直接返回指定文件的内容。以上就是在PHP中读取指定文件内容的方法和操作流程。通过使用文件打开函数fopen()来打开文件,然后使用文件读取函数fread()或者file_get_contents()来读取文件的内容,最后使用文件关闭函数fclose()关闭文件句柄。结合小标题展示,内容结构清晰。文章字数大于3000字。
2年前